Pink

The color #E776A1 is a pink that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 231, 118, 161 and HSL values of 337°, 70%, 68%.

Complementary Colors for #E776A1

The complementary color for #E776A1 is #74E7BB.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#E776A1

The analogous colors for #E776A1 are #E774D9 and #E78274.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#E776A1

The triadic colors for #E776A1 are #A0E774 and #74A0E7.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
